Description
Summary:We describe the equivalence groupoid of the class of general Burgers-Korteweg-de Vries equations with space-dependent coefficients.This class is shown to reduce by a family of equivalence transformations to a subclass with a four-dimensional usual equivalence group.Classified are admissible transformations of this subclass and singled out its subclasses admitting maximal nontrivial conditional equivalence groups.All of them turn out to have dimension higher than four.In particular, few new examples of nontrivial cases of normalization in the generalized sense of classes of differential equationsappeared this way. Neither of classes discussed possesses a unique effective generalized equivalence group.
